Why Live in North Brookfield

North Brookfield, MA, situated in west Worcester County, is characterized by expansive green farmland, dense forests, and historic main streets. This rural community blends historical charm with modern development, featuring a Victorian-style public library built in 1893 and a solar farm. The area is known for its laid-back environment and reasonable tax rates, making it convenient for commuters. Homes in North Brookfield range from 19th-century colonials and 1970s split-levels to early 2000s Colonial Revivals, with properties on both gridded roads near North Main Street and rural streets. Residents enjoy outdoor recreation at Sucker Brook Wildlife Management Area, where they can hunt, fish, hike, and observe wildlife, and Moore State Park, located 10 miles northeast, offers trails with views of an old sawmill, pond, and waterfall. Dining options include casual Italian eateries like Jim’s Pizza and North Brookfield Pizza Palace, as well as farm-fresh dishes at Farmer Matt’s restaurant, located 4 miles northwest. Common Ground Ciderworks provides a local nightlife scene with craft fairs, live music, and musical bingo. The Haston Free Public Library hosts various community events, including story times, art clubs, and book group meetings. While the area is car-dependent, state highways offer routes to Worcester, 20 miles east, and major highways leading to Boston, 70 miles east.
